On Wednesday, April 7th, residents will be welcomed back inside all branches of the Clearview Public Library. Normal hours of operation will resume, with hours at the Stayner and Creemore Branches being extended to 9:00 pm Wednesday to Friday, and a lunchtime closure Fridays between 1:00 and 2:00 pm at the Creemore Branch. Curbside service will continue to be offered.
Changes made in 2020 to comply with provincial safety regulations will remain. Before entering a library branch, a paper self-assessment form must be completed and deposited into the provided collection bin. Face masks are mandatory and capacity limits are in place. Traffic will continue to be regulated by directional and physical distancing floor stickers and posters.
Increased cleaning protocols will continue, including:
- A quarantine period of five days for returned materials.
- Cleaning of public computer mice and keyboards after each use.
- Nightly professional cleaning of public washrooms, and sanitization of high-touch surfaces throughout the day.
- Bins have been provided at the end of each aisle for used materials.
Library visits remain limited to one hour per day and public computer use to half-an-hour per day. Printing and faxing will be available with exact change.
